How to Manage Investment Risks

... are not guaranteed: a company may reduce or even eliminate its dividend payments. This usually occurs if the company's profit declines or financial difficulties arise, such as reduced income or increased debts. At times, even in favorable situations, management may decide to reinvest profits back into the business, leaving shareholders without distributions. For investors focused on generating dividend income, such a decision can be quite disappointing. First, it means they miss out on anticipated investment income. Accel: A venture capital fund that supports startups around the world

... plan. This is essential for achieving successful financial results and attracting subsequent rounds of investment. Innovative Technologies and Business Models Accel invests in companies leveraging advanced technologies or developing new approaches to business, providing them with competitive advantages in the market. Average Investment Size and Fund Capital Accel manages assets totaling over $12 billion and has several funds focused on different investment stages: Seed Investments: typically range from $500,000 to $3 million.
